Let me point out that LTSP works fine with SuSE 7.3 and that the LTSP distro consists of 2 parts. 1. Everything to get the correct server daemons going (DHCP, TFTP, NFS, X, XCMP, ...). This is all described in the documentation. This can be done be creating related files (like /etc/dhcpd.conf), which you have to do anyway. 2.) The distro itself, with all the files the Workstation sees (kernel, rootfs, etc.) This is the same and has nothing to do with the server any more. I'd say samples of all config files and their location for latest SuSE should help already. A ready to go install-script helps here, but you will understand better if you follow the documentation and adapt the samples. I can put them together if wanted.
